The collision angle is a protrusion fixed to the bow to destroy an enemy ship, usually hidden under the water (the long rod on the bow is not a collision angle), and was widely used by ancient Phoenicians, Greeks and Romans However, in the 18th century, popular artillery bombardment basically withdrew from the historical stage, and it was not until the middle of the 19th century that it once again ushered in a revival on iron armored ships.
